GeForce RTX 3060 12GB vs Arc B570: In-Depth Breakdown
Performance: GeForce RTX 3060 12GB vs Arc B570
The GeForce RTX 3060 12GB is marginally faster, around 6% ahead of the Arc B570. Both cards sit in the same broad class, well suited to 1080p.
Power & Efficiency
At 150W against 170W, the Arc B570 is both the lower-power and the more efficient card, making it the easier build to cool and power. Its more modern Battlemage architecture on a TSMC N5 process is part of why it does more with each watt.
VRAM & Future-Proofing
The GeForce RTX 3060 12GB carries 12GB versus 10GB on the Arc B570. The extra 2GB helps at 4K, with high-resolution texture packs, and for content-creation or local-AI workloads that exhaust smaller buffers.
Generation & Longevity
The Arc B570 is roughly 4 years newer than the GeForce RTX 3060 12GB (Battlemage vs Ampere), so it generally benefits from a more modern architecture and longer driver-support runway.
Features & Ecosystem
Beyond raw numbers, the Arc B570 brings Intel XeSS upscaling and AV1 encoding, while the GeForce RTX 3060 12GB offers NVIDIA DLSS upscaling/frame generation and stronger ray tracing. If you lean on upscaling or ray tracing, that ecosystem difference can matter as much as the frame-rate gap.

Technical Specifications Comparison
Architecture & Cores
| Specification | Arc B570 | GeForce RTX 3060 12GB |
|---|---|---|
| Architecture | Battlemage | Ampere |
| Process Node | TSMC N5 | Samsung 8nm |
| CUDA Cores (Shading Units / CUDA Cores) | 2,304 | 3,584✓ |
| Ray Tracing Cores | 18 | 28✓ |
| Tensor / AI Cores | 144✓ | 112 |
Clock Speeds
| Specification | Arc B570 | GeForce RTX 3060 12GB |
|---|---|---|
| Base Clock | 2,500 MHz✓ | 1,320 MHz |
| Boost Clock | 2,750 MHz✓ | 1,777 MHz |
Memory
| Specification | Arc B570 | GeForce RTX 3060 12GB |
|---|---|---|
| VRAM Capacity | 10 GB | 12 GB✓ |
| Memory Type | GDDR6 | GDDR6 |
| Memory Bus | 160-bit | 192-bit✓ |
| Memory Speed | 19 Gbps✓ | 15 Gbps |
| Bandwidth | 380 GB/s✓ | 360 GB/s |
Connectivity & Power
| Specification | Arc B570 | GeForce RTX 3060 12GB |
|---|---|---|
| Interface | PCIe 4.0 x8 | PCIe 4.0 x16 |
| TDP | 150 W✓ | 170 W |
| Power Connectors | 1x 8-pin | 1x 8-pin |
| Released | Jan 2025 | Feb 2021 |
